We hope you enjoy diversity! Notably, each Dave's location serves a unique and sometimes ethnically diverse community.
We have strived to merchandise each store to cater to the specific grocery needs of the surrounding neighborhood.
From the largest variety of Hispanic foods in Cleveland at our Ridge Road Mercado to the expanded assortment of specialty foods, natural foods and organic foods at our Cedar Lee store to Kosher selections at Severence Town Center, you should be able to always find what you are looking for.
We believe this sets us apart from other grocers.
We believe it is part of the reason we have thirteen store locations and have been in business since 1930.

Don't Be Fooled

The fraudster will send a check to the victim who has accepted a job. The check can be for multiple reasons such as signing bonus, supplies, etc. The victim will be instructed to deposit the check and use the money for any of these reasons and then instructed to send the remaining funds to the fraudster. The check will bounce and the victim is left responsible.
